- 博客(12)
- 资源 (3)
- 收藏
- 关注
原创 微信公众号自动回复用户信息
首先实现这个功能有2种方法:1、微信公众号管理员直接在后台设置自动回复(这个只能设置固定的回复);2、如果我们需要根据用户发送的消息查询动态的数据并回复,就只能通过代码实现自定义的回复了;测试:我们首先需要一个测试微信测试账号(微信测试账号看开通请看:申请微信测试账号)其次我们需要有个能让外网访问的地址(我这边使用的是内网穿透工具,natapp)以上就是映射的域名及其对应的本地地址;下面我们就可以在8084这个端口下,实现写我们的实现代码;1、我们需要在公众号管理平台..
2022-01-07 15:30:45 2613 1
原创 nodejs+cheerio 实现简单的网页采集(可实现简单的组装页面)
1:首先可以先获取你需要采集的网页的地址:url2:将你需要采集的url用nodejs实现请求:const cheerio = require('cheerio');const restler = Object.assign({}, require("restler"));import htmlObject from '../utils/html-str.js';im...
2018-05-23 16:25:23 673
原创 未知高度的div在父元素中水平垂直居中的方法
居中方法暂时找到两种:1、父元素:在父元素中使用:display: flex;justify-content: center;align-items: center;这些属性,即可以让子元素垂直居中:其中:justify-content:是在主轴上的对齐方式,即X轴align-items:是在Y轴上的对齐方式,针对于在只有一条轴...
2017-04-07 10:20:27 7734
原创 事件的三个阶段
一个事件的处理过程主要有三个阶段:捕获,目标,冒泡;(1)捕获:当我们在 DOM 树的某个节点发生了一些操作(例如单击、鼠标移动上去),就会有一个事件发射过去。这个事件从 Window 发出,不断经过下级节点直到触发的目标节点。在到达目标节点之前的过程,就是捕获阶段(Capture Phase)。(所有经过的节点,都会触发这个事件。捕获阶段的任务就是建立这个事件传递路线,以便后面冒泡阶段顺
2016-08-12 16:17:41 4699
原创 对css3动画事件的监听
关于对css3动画事件是否结束的监听:css3的动画主要有两种方式:1、-webkit-animation动画其实有三个事件: 开始事件 webkitAnimationStart 结束事件 webkitAnimationEnd 重复运动事件 webkitAnimationIteration2、css3的过渡属性transiti
2016-05-25 14:30:39 1764
原创 js的原型(prototype)的相关笔记(一)
1.在js中用原型来实现继承,原型可以动态的往类中添加相关的函数 2.当函数直接用对象的形式写时是不具有prototype属性的,如:,原型属性只有当其是函数时才具有 3.某函数原型的属性是不能覆盖其本身的属性的,如: 4.每个函数都有一个prototype属性,这个属性是指向一个对象的引用,这个对象称为原型对象。 写函数有几种方式: (1)写成对象,数组形式 var m={ m:2,
2015-07-15 17:30:06 346
原创 文章标题jquery的this与$(this)的区别与联系
this:this操作的是HTML对象,为html对象,为this中的属性复制就是直接this.属性名=赋值 (this):操作的是jQuery对象,所以它具有jquery对象的所有方法,这个赋值的话:(this):操作的是jQuery对象,所以它具有jquery对象的所有方法,这个赋值的话:(this).attr(‘name’,”zhangsan”);
2015-07-15 17:09:17 301
转载 jquery与Dom元素的互换
1.将Jquery对象转换为Dom元素:(1)jQuery对象是一个数据对象,可以通过[index]的方法,来得到相应的DOM对象。如:var $v =$("#v") ; //jQuery对象var v=$v[0]; //DOM对象alert(v.checked) //检测这个checkbox是否被选中(2)jQuery本身提供,通过.get(index)方法,得到相应的D
2015-07-15 16:58:33 586
原创 jquery innerHeight(),outerHeight(),height()的区别
innerHeight();计算的是div的content+padding的高度outerHeight();//计算的是content+padding+border的高度height();//计算的是content的高度
2015-07-15 16:54:09 307
原创 事件委托的个人理解
首先事件委托:是根据事件冒泡的机制实现的事件委托一般用(jquery委托的目标).on("事件名称","需要委托的dom元素",function(e){……//执行的函数体 })来绑定。其中:e.currentTarget表示需要委托dom元素e.target表示触发事件的dom元素委托的目标一般为需要委托的所有元素共有的父元素如:...
2015-07-13 13:32:50 908
原创 解决bootstrap的tooltip插件不能自动定位不是相对于浏览器窗口定位的问题
tooltip的插件参数:选项名称 类型/默认值 Data 属性名称 描述 animation boolean默认值:true data-animation 向工具提示应用 CSS 褪色过渡效果。 html boolean默认值:false data-html 向工具提示插入 HTML。如果为 false,jQuery 的 t...
2015-07-13 13:18:06 4075 2
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人